Highlights

  • Zip Line: A major draw for kids, Meander Park features a large zip line that provides hours of fun.
  • Trampoline and Climbing Equipment: The park is equipped with mini trampolines, a large climbing rope structure, and stone-hopping areas, which offer plenty of opportunities for physical activity.
  • Walkways and Trails: Paved bike and walking paths meander through the park and connect to a secondary park with a soccer field, making it an ideal location for family strolls or bike rides.
  • Pond and Natural Features: The park includes a small pond and various natural brush areas, enhancing its scenic appeal.
  • Hidden Art: Art installations hidden along the trails add an element of surprise and delight for those exploring the park.

Tips

  • Parking: Parking space is limited, so it might be necessary to park on the side of the street.
  • Ideal for All Ages: The park’s amenities cater to kids of all ages, making it perfect for family outings.
  • Quiet and Clean: Visitors have noted the park’s calm and clean environment, ideal for relaxation and unwinding.

2022 June 4.5★ Not your typical playground. This park boasts some great special features - a Large zip line, jumping stones/stone hop and large climbing rope structure. A nice walkway and hiking path with a small pond compliments this park. Park on the side of the street.

Great park with mini zip line, mini trampoline and boulder hopping. Equipment is in good shape. The hidden gem is the bike/walking path around the park and then through some natural brush to a secondary park with a soccer field. All paved about 500 meters and perfect for young kids. Some hidden art along the way.
